After 8 years in Oakland, this ube pizza purveyor is closing its doors
Briefly

Spinning Dough, a pizzeria known for its unique ube and longanisa pizzas, is set to close on April 20 after eight successful years. Owner Jeff Chin expressed gratitude towards his supporters and reflected on treasured memories while hinting at new ventures in his life. The decision to shut down comes after a health scare that nearly led to the restaurant's closure in 2023. The final chapter of Spinning Dough takes place at its West Oakland location, leaving behind a legacy of creative pizza.
